Boussouar El Maghnaoui

Boussouar El Maghnaoui (El Maghnawi) (born 1955 in Oujda, Morocco) is a Moroccan singer-songwriter in Oujda city (Morocco).[1]

Discography

  • Khodi brayti / Ya zina diri latay (Hillali, recorded in 1975)
  • EP with Gana el Maghnaoui (El Anwar, 1977)
  • Dayak oulabasse / Salamate salamate with Bellemou Messaoud (El Mehar, 1978)
  • Dayek ou labes / Salamate salamate (Azhar)
  • LP with Boutaiba Sghir (Edition MK7)
  • LP with Fadila
  • Pop Ray (Ouaka, 1986)
  • Gouli oui oui (Believe / Brahim Ounassar, 2013)
